Stavros Flatley star Lagi Demetriou is all grown up and is set to become a father.

The 25-year-old former dancer - who found fame with his 53-year-old dad Demi on Britain’s Got Talent back in 2009 - has shared a sweet video on TikTok announcing that his fiancee Annika Crawford is expecting their first child.

Demetriou captioned the video, which shows him kissing her baby bump: "To another new chapter with my beautiful wife to be. I love you @neekzs."

The pair introduced the clip: "The reason we have been gone for the last 5 months! We have been keeping a little secret."

The couple have been together for five years and became engaged on New Year's Eve 2020.

Demetriou and his father took part in ITV talent show BGT in 2009 as a dance duo combining Cypriot and Irish dancing. They finished fourth in the third series, the same year as Diversity and Susan Boyle competed on the show.

In 2019 Stavros Flatley took part in Britain’s Got Talent: The Champions, competing against BGT favourites such as singers Collabro, Connie Talbot and Paul Potts, stand-up comedian Lee Ridley AKA Lost Voice Guy, sword-swallower Alexandr Magala, dog act and season four runners-up, dancing duo Twist and Pulse.

At the end of the show Lagi announced he was quitting the dance act.

He said: "We’ve done this for 10 years for a joke.

“We’ve done so many amazing things but what is there left to do? We’ve done the Royal Variety, we’ve played in China, Monaco - everywhere. So when we got to The Champions, I thought this was the right time to leave.”

Lagi now works as a barber, while his father Demi continues to perform as Stavros Flatley with his 19-year-old nephew Samson.
